But I have also a question : when you look at a diamond which has exactly the same characteristics : gia certified, same carat, same cut, same color, same clarity: what makes the difference in price (sometimes more than 1000$ for a 1.30k stone).
The prices vary for several reasons. Eye-cleanliness is a big deal as do other characteristics (table/depth size, fluorescence). But the big difference would be the suppliers.
